Therapeutic Health Choices, LLC (THC) is a cannabis safety testing laboratory.  It provides analytical chemistry and microbiology testing services for cannabis cultivators and processors as mandated by the state of Michigan.  THC is a small, privately held company that provides access to a healthcare and 401(k) plan.  It offers an exceptional work environment and long-term growth opportunities in an expanding market.  If you work smart, play hard, and want to use your technical skills in a rapidly expanding laboratory sector, we’d love to hear from you!

Essential functions:

Technical

  • Oversees day to day operations by managing multiple analytical projects related to the development, qualification and/or troubleshooting of sensitive, efficient, and reliable assays for a wide class of molecules simultaneously.
  • Prepares, reviews, and edits method transfer, qualification, and validation protocols, analytical technical reports, and regulatory documentation.
  • Ensures test results are accurate and valid.
  • Maintains equipment and instruments in good operating condition recognize any malfunctions and troubleshoot as needed.
  • Completes routine preventive maintenance and troubleshooting on instruments and equipment.
  • Provides technical expertise and advises project representatives/teams on topics pertaining to assay analysis and development.  Often presents findings and/or results to client senior management.
  • Provides technical guidance to others in resolving challenging issues relating to analytical methods.
  • Validate reporting requirements in the statewide monitoring system.
  • Performs other tasks as specified by the manager/director and/or duties required and published by regulatory agencies.

Regulatory

  • May act in the capacity of a Cannabis Laboratory Testing Analyst.
  • Ensures compliance with all regulatory agency requirements (MRA, LARA, ISO, etc.) through documentation, audits, and corrective action.
  • Participate in the development of new SOPs, validations new tests
  • Performs quality control procedures to ensure accuracy of clinical data.
  • Participates in the updating of departmental standard operating procedures and database to accurately reflect the current practices.
  • Responsible for maintaining updated understanding and knowledge of the methods employed in the laboratory.
  • Ensure employment of personnel who are competent to perform test procedures, and report test results promptly, accurately, and proficiently.
